While PowerPoint on mobile was clunky in 2012, OfficeSuite Pro v5.5.748 introduced a "Presenter" view. Users could run slideshows directly from their device, view speaker notes privately, and use on-screen transitions—all without a laptop. OfficeSuite Pro v5.5.748

: v5.5.748 included a high-quality PDF viewer that allowed for text search and "text reflow," making reading long documents on small screens significantly easier.
